An evacuated glass vessel weighs $50.0 \hspace {1mm} g$ when empty $148.0 g$ when filled with a liquid of density $0.98 \hspace {1mm} g \hspace {1mm} mL^{-1}$ and $50.5 g$ when filled with an ideal gas at $760 \hspace {1mm} mm \hspace {1mm} Hg$ at $300 \hspace {1mm} K$. Determine the molar mass of the gas.

Correct Answer: 74. $(123 {~g}{~mol}^{-1})$

Solution:

Mass of liquid $=148-50=98 \hspace {1mm} g$

$\Rightarrow$ Volume of liquid $=\dfrac{98}{0.98}=100 \hspace {1mm} mL=$ volume of flask

mass of gas $=50.5-50=0.50 g$

Now applying ideal gas equation : $p V=\left(\dfrac{w}{M}\right) R T$

$\Rightarrow \quad M=\dfrac{w R T}{p V}=\dfrac{0.5 \times 0.082 \times 300}{1 \times 0.1}=123 {~g} {~mol}^{-1}$
